Provon does not require a Provon-specific inference SDK. The stable contract is the Gateway base URL, Bearer authentication, request model, and optional evidence-context headers.
Shared Configuration#
export PROVON_GATEWAY_URL="http://127.0.0.1:3000/gateway/v1"
export PROVON_API_KEY="your_project_api_key"PROVON_API_KEY is a Provon project API key with gateway:invoke. Do not put an upstream provider
key in the application.
Clients that read the standard OpenAI environment variables can often be redirected without code changes:
export OPENAI_BASE_URL="$PROVON_GATEWAY_URL"
export OPENAI_API_KEY="$PROVON_API_KEY"Use a provider-qualified model such as openai/gpt-5-mini during migration. Introduce plain model
names or provon/auto only after routing policy has been tested.
Direct HTTP#
Any HTTP client can call the Gateway:
const response = await fetch(`${process.env.PROVON_GATEWAY_URL}/chat/completions`, {
method: 'POST',
headers: {
Authorization: `Bearer ${process.env.PROVON_API_KEY}`,
'Content-Type': 'application/json',
'x-otel-gen-ai-conversation-id': 'conversation-123',
'x-otel-gen-ai-agent-id': 'support-agent',
},
body: JSON.stringify({
model: 'openai/gpt-5-mini',
messages: [{ role: 'user', content: 'Summarize this ticket.' }],
}),
});
if (!response.ok) throw new Error(await response.text());
console.log(await response.json());Log the x-provon-request-id response header with the application request:
console.log(response.headers.get('x-provon-request-id'));OpenAI Python SDK#

Frameworks And OpenAI-Compatible Clients#
For LangChain, LlamaIndex, Vercel AI SDK, or another framework:
- Select its OpenAI or OpenAI-compatible provider adapter.
- Set the base URL to
PROVON_GATEWAY_URL. - Set the API key to
PROVON_API_KEY. - Use a model ID available in the Provon capability matrix.
- Add the context headers through the framework's default-header or per-request option.
Framework configuration names change across releases. The invariant contract is:
Base URL: https://<gateway-origin>/gateway/v1
Authorization: Bearer <Provon project API key>
Model: <provider>/<model>, plain policy model, or provon/autoDo not add a second /v1 when the configured Gateway URL already ends in /gateway/v1.
The client must be able to send Authorization: Bearer <Provon project API key>. A client that
hard-codes provider-specific authentication without a header override is not drop-in compatible.
Native Messages Requests#
Provon also exposes /gateway/v1/messages for provider-native Messages payloads. Use Bearer
authentication even when the upstream provider normally uses x-api-key:
curl "$PROVON_GATEWAY_URL/messages" \
-H "Authorization: Bearer $PROVON_API_KEY" \
-H "Content-Type: application/json" \
-H "anthropic-version: 2023-06-01" \
-H "x-otel-gen-ai-conversation-id: conversation-123" \
-d '{
"model": "anthropic/claude-haiku-4.5",
"max_tokens": 256,
"messages": [{"role": "user", "content": "Summarize this ticket."}]
}'The selected target must declare the messages endpoint and native passthrough capability. Query
the capability matrix instead of assuming parity.
Diagnostic Context#
Stable context makes individual model calls useful to conversation diagnostics:
| Purpose | Header |
|---|---|
| Conversation | x-otel-gen-ai-conversation-id |
| User | x-otel-user-id |
| Session | x-otel-session-id |
| Agent | x-otel-gen-ai-agent-id |
| Agent name | x-otel-gen-ai-agent-name |
| Agent build | x-otel-gen-ai-agent-version |
| Workflow | x-otel-gen-ai-workflow-name |
Use the same conversation ID for every turn in one user goal. Use non-secret, pseudonymous values; these headers become retained trace attributes.
Set request-scoped values such as conversation, session, and user IDs on each request. Do not place one user's identifiers in process-wide default headers. Agent name and version can be client-wide when one client instance represents one deployed agent.
Migration Checklist#
- Connect one Provider Key and keep Request traces set to All.
- Verify the application endpoint ends in
/gateway/v1. - Replace the provider key with a Provon project key.
- Start with a provider-qualified model.
- Send stable conversation and agent identifiers.
- Test streaming, tools, structured output, and multimodal inputs separately.
- Verify the root and provider-attempt spans in Traces.
- Add limits, guardrails, and recovery policy before increasing traffic.
